BLUE STARS NOTEBOOK (2009/07/02)
HOW THEY DID: The La Crosse Blue Stars have won two silver medals and one bronze medal in the past week. They scored a season-high 74.7 points Tuesday and took third place behind the Cavaliers of Rosemont, Ill., (79 points) and Phantom Regiment of Rockford, Ill. (78.4 points) in Dubuque, Iowa. They scored 74.5 points for second place Sunday in Madison and 73.3 points for second place June 25 in West Des Moines, Iowa. They scored 70.4 points for fourth place June 26 at DCI Central Illinois, the first major competition of the season.

BLUE STARS NOTEBOOK (2009/06/26)
HOW THEY DID: The La Crosse Blue Stars scored 72.6 points Tuesday to win the silver medal at the Sioux Empire Spectacular in Sioux Falls, S.D. The Blue Stars hit the 70-point mark for the first time this season in finishing only four points behind the Phantom Regiment, last year’s world champions who won the contest with 76.9 points.
